Melanie Fryer, 47, of Dartmouth passed away unexpectedly at Saint Luke's hospital on September 13, 2022, in New Bedford. She was the wife of Robert Fryer and was born in New Bedford, MA to parents Carole (Bourgeois) MacArthur and the late Albert J. D'Arruda.


Melanie "Mel" grew up in Dartmouth, MA and moved briefly to Plainfield, IN graduating from high school in 1993. She studied at Endicott College and held several jobs throughout the service industry where she was known for her warm and friendly customer service often taking the time to get to know her guests.


Melanie was a devoted wife and mother. She was always there when you needed her and would drop everything to help someone in need. She was a good friend to many and was kind, funny and always the brightest light in the room. She easily found joy in the smallest things in life and enjoyed spending time with family and friends. She also loved hockey, nature, her beloved pets and snuggling to watch her favorite re-runs. She will be dearly missed.


She is survived by her husband Robert Fryer; her mother Carole MacArthur and step-father Henry MacArthur of Dartmouth; her children Cameron Fryer, Livia Fryer and Lillian Fryer of Dartmouth; her brother Albert D'Arruda and his wife Suzie of Smyrna Mills, Maine; her sister Lynne Galipeau and her spouse Peter of Dartmouth; her step-brother Jason Cordeiro and spouse Cindy of Plainfield, IN; her step-sister Amy MacArthur in Edmonton, Alberta; her mother-in-law Linda Fryer of Fairhaven, father-in-law Kenneth Fryer of Plant City, FL; nieces and nephews Emma Fryer, Sarah Ze Galipeau, Nathan Galipeau, Steven D'Arruda and Kaden Cordeiro; and several aunts, uncles, cousins and in-laws. She was pre-deceased by her father Albert J. D'Arruda.


Relatives and friends are invited to attend a time of visitation on Friday, November 25, 2022 from 10am-12pm in the Donaghy-New Day Funeral Home, 465 County St., New Bedford. Prayers and Words of Remembrance will begin at 12pm.


Burial will be private.
